Несколько подходов для улучшения дизайна интерфейсов с помощью Tkinter:
- Использование контейнеров. 1 Они позволяют разделять различные логические части интерфейса, добавляя структуру и ясность. 1
- Обработка событий. 1 Система обработки событий в Tkinter связывает действия пользователя с выполнением определённых программных функций. 1 Это делает приложение более интерактивным. 1
- Улучшение визуальной составляющей. 1 Для этого можно использовать:
- Выбор шрифтов. 1 Хорошо подобранный шрифт способен изменить общее впечатление от приложения. 1 Использование различных типов и размеров шрифтов для заголовков и основного текста сделает информацию более доступной. 1
- Цветовые схемы. 1 Подбор гармоничной палитры цветов позволяет создать настроение и привлечь внимание к важным элементам. 1 Необходимо учитывать контрастность, чтобы текст оставался читаемым на фоне. 1
- Отступы и выравнивание. 1 Правильное расстояние между элементами интерфейса и их выравнивание играют ключевую роль в организации информации и улучшении восприятия. 1
- Стили кнопок. 1 Кнопки могут выделяться благодаря эффектам наведения или изменениям цвета. 1 Это не только привлекает внимание, но и предоставляет обратную связь пользователю. 1
Также для создания более современного дизайна интерфейсов в Tkinter можно использовать библиотеку CustomTkinter, которая предоставляет набор новых виджетов, тем и стилей. 4